Or: [...] How to spot a Bootleg item: KNOW what studio authorized items should look like by examining the packaging. ARTWORK (front and back) should be colorful, clear and professional. Knowing all this information will help you determine that your CD is not a bootleg. ITEM maybe re-wrapped, meaning it has been opened and someone may have re-wrapped with a cellophane machine. Especially be wary of this as many sellers will sell you re-wrapped used item as new. BOOTLEGS are usually way cheaper than the originals. Many buyers are tempted because of this. Be warned that if you buy such items there is no guarantee that it will play. Most bootleg disc have a kind of bluish tint to the playing side of the disc. Also, the artwork on the disc is usually very different than the original. AUTHORIZED CD'S DON'T LOOK LIKE A CDR. With technical innovations and un-monitored productions, sometimes unauthorized CD's which have not been authorized by the copyright owners get listed for sale. Such instance occurs frequently and its hard to tell the differences, but with the knowledge of knowing what to look for, you are now able to determine your product more effectively.
